The Hanged Man
Upright: pause, surrender, letting go, new perspectives
Reversed: stalling, needless sacrifice, fear of sacrifice
Five of Cups
Upright: loss, grief, regret, disappointment
Reversed: acceptance, moving on, finding peace
Ace of Pentacles
Upright: opportunity, prosperity, new venture, abundance
Reversed: lost opportunity, lack of planning, scarcity

The Hanged Man Reversed
The Hanged Man reversed often signals resistance to letting go, clinging to outdated patterns that hinder growth. This may lead to feelings of stagnation and frustration, as the urge for action overshadows the need for reflection.
Five of Cups Reversed
The Five of Cups reversed offers a glimmer of hope, suggesting healing and the potential to move beyond past grief. It encourages the release of sorrow, allowing for appreciation of what remains and the promise of brighter days ahead.
Ace of Pentacles Reversed
The Ace of Pentacles reversed warns of missed opportunities and a lack of focus on material goals. It may indicate a need to reassess priorities, as potential gains could slip through one's fingers if not actively pursued.
